Pheonix Adult Partial Program Crcsi is a mental health clinic in Uniontown, PA. It is located at 100 New Salem Road, Uniontown, PA 15401. Pheonix Adult Partial Program Crcsi offers outpatient treatment, residential treatment and partial hospitalization/day treatment and is categorized as an outpatient mental health facility. Included in the treatment are group therapy, couples/family therapy and trauma therapy. Staff members who work at Pheonix Adult Partial Program Crcsi are well-trained in providing treatment to seniors 65 or older, young adults and adults with mental health problems. Additionally, Pheonix Adult Partial Program Crcsi offers treatment to people requiring dual diagnosis treatment, people with serious mental illness and patients with eating disorders. Other services that Pheonix Adult Partial Program Crcsi offers consist of supported housing, family psychoeducation and diet and exercise counseling.
